Dubai: The first Casper theme park in the Middle East will be opened in Dubai by the first quarter of next year. Construction on the Casper Theme Park, located at Dubai Festival Centre, will begin shortly.

Casper, the cartoon ghost, is already a very lucrative retail brand, worth around $1 billion (Dh3.67 billion).

The park will be 6,340 square metres in size and will include the Middle East's biggest monorail.

The park will also feature a rollercoaster, interactive games, bumper cars, crazy rafts and a drop tower.

Al Futtaim Group Real Estate (Afgre) is working alongside Kuwait-based Future Kid Entertainment and Real Estate Company.

"Festival Centre has always been recognised as a leading entertainment destination and this success, along with a few other exciting concepts we plan to announce shortly, reinforces our belief that Festival Centre is the number one retail and leisure destination in Dubai," said Philip Evans, director of retail leasing, Afgre.
